@font-face{font-family:'lato';src:url('Lato-Reg.eot');src:url('Lato-Reg.eot?#iefix') format('embedded-opentype'),url('Lato-Reg.woff') format('woff'),url('Lato-Reg.ttf') format('truetype');font-weight:normal;font-style:normal}@font-face{font-family:'lato';src:url('Lato-RegIta.eot');src:url('Lato-RegIta.eot?#iefix') format('embedded-opentype'),url('Lato-RegIta.woff') format('woff'),url('Lato-RegIta.ttf') format('truetype');font-weight:normal;font-style:italic}@font-face{font-family:'lato';src:url('Lato-Black.eot');src:url('Lato-Black.eot?#iefix') format('embedded-opentype'),url('Lato-Black.woff') format('woff'),url('Lato-Black.ttf') format('truetype');font-weight:bold;font-style:normal}@font-face{font-family:'lato';src:url('Lato-BolIta.eot');src:url('Lato-BolIta.eot?#iefix') format('embedded-opentype'),url('Lato-BolIta.woff') format('woff'),url('Lato-BolIta.ttf') format('truetype');font-weight:bold;font-style:italic}@font-face{font-family:'lato_light';src:url('Lato-Lig.eot');src:url('Lato-Lig.eot?#iefix') format('embedded-opentype'),url('Lato-Lig.woff') format('woff'),url('Lato-Lig.ttf') format('truetype');font-weight:normal;font-style:normal}@font-face{font-family:'lato_light';src:url('Lato-LigIta.eot');src:url('Lato-LigIta.eot?#iefix') format('embedded-opentype'),url('Lato-LigIta.svg#latolight_italic') format('svg'),url('Lato-LigIta.woff') format('woff'),url('Lato-LigIta.ttf') format('truetype');font-weight:normal;font-style:italic}*:hover,*:active,*:focus{outline:0}button::-moz-focus-inner,input[type="reset"]::-moz-focus-inner,input[type="button"]::-moz-focus-inner,input[type="submit"]::-moz-focus-inner,input[type="file"]>input[type="button"]::-moz-focus-inner{border:0}::-webkit-input-placeholder{color:#aaa;letter-spacing:1px;opacity:1}:-moz-placeholder{color:#aaa;letter-spacing:1px;opacity:1}::-moz-placeholder{color:#aaa;letter-spacing:1px;opacity:1}:-ms-input-placeholder{color:#aaa;letter-spacing:1px;opacity:1}div.desc ::-webkit-input-placeholder{font-size:11px}div.desc ::-moz-input-placeholder{font-size:11px}div.desc :-moz-input-placeholder{font-size:11px}div.desc :-ms-input-placeholder{font-size:11px}.hidden,input[type="radio"],input[type="checkbox"]{display:none}input[type="text"],input[type="password"],input[type="email"],textarea,select{border:0;margin:0;padding:5px;box-sizing:border-box}input[type="text"],input[type="email"],input[type="password"],input[type="submit"],textarea{font-size:inherit}input[type="text"],input[type="email"],input[type="password"],select{height:30px;line-height:30px}input[type="text"],input[type="email"],input[type="password"],select,textarea{margin-bottom:15px}img{border:0}img.notvisible{opacity:0}img.responsive{max-width:100%;height:auto}input[type="checkbox"]{display:none}a{color:inherit;text-decoration:underline}a[href^="http"]{color:#a78c6c}html,body{height:100%}body{font-family:lato;color:#333;min-height:100%;margin:0;font-size:14px;letter-spacing:1px;line-height:20px;display:table;width:100%;background:#8fb12e url(../img/bg.jpg) top center no-repeat;background-size:100%}#page{display:table-cell;vertical-align:middle;text-align:center}#page>*{width:80%;max-width:360px;display:inline-block;box-sizing:border-box}#page div.error{margin:50px 0 0 0;background:#f00;color:#fff;font-size:20px;text-align:center;padding:20px;line-height:25px;border-radius:5px}#page div.slogan{margin-top:50px;margin-bottom:-10px}#page div.slogan img{max-width:100%;display:block}#form{background:#77992b;padding:20px;color:#fff;border-radius:5px;text-align:left;margin-bottom:50px;position:relative}#form input[name^="kod"]{width:18px;margin:0;text-align:center}#form div.images{position:absolute;left:0;top:0}#form div.images img{position:absolute;left:0;top:0}#form div.images img.promocja{left:-400px;top:-200px}#form div.images img.n50{left:450px;top:-130px}#form div.images img.n100{left:-200px;top:100px}#form div.images img.grupa{left:-300px;top:250px}#step1 fieldset.kody{text-align:justify}#step1 fieldset.kody:after{content:'';width:100%;display:inline-block}#form input[type="submit"]{margin:0 auto;display:block;padding:10px 20px;color:#fff;border-radius:5px;border:1px solid #57771c;text-transform:uppercase;background:#abc945;background:-moz-linear-gradient(top,#abc945 0,#70a329 100%);background:-webkit-linear-gradient(top,#abc945 0,#70a329 100%);background:linear-gradient(to bottom,#abc945 0,#70a329 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#abc945',endColorstr='#70a329',GradientType=0)}#step2 label{text-align:right;width:100%;display:block}#step2 input[type="text"],#step2 input[type="email"]{margin-left:10px;border-radius:5px;width:158px}#step2 input[type="submit"]{margin:0;display:inline-block;width:158px}#step3 a.regulamin{margin:0 auto}